Featuring sea views, Fisherman's Cottage provides accommodation with a patio and a kettle, around 0.9 miles from Great Molunan Beach. This holiday home features a garden, barbecue facilities, free WiFi and free private parking.
This holiday home comes with a seating area, a flat-screen TV, a Blu-ray player and a kitchen with a dishwasher.
The holiday home offers a terrace.
St Mawes Castle is less than 0.6 miles from Fisherman's Cottage. The nearest airport is Newquay Cornwall Airport, 19.9 miles from the accommodation.
Beautiful period cottage just a couple of minutes walk from the beaches, bars, restaurants, galleries, pubs and shops of the bustling old fishing village of St Mawes. Relax on the large sun deck with a glass of wine, looking out at the boats across the harbour. Or recline in the cosy cottage sitting room in front of the log burner, playing a selection of board games. 60mb wifi and parking space included, as are towels and bed linen.
Fisherman's Cottage is brilliantly located in the heart of St Mawes. The sea/beach, The Rising Sun pub and Idle Rocks Hotel (boasting an excellent cocktail bar and restaurant!) are within 100 metres of the property. There are several very decent pubs and restaurants just a short walk away. An excellent mini-supermarket, Post Office, butcher, baker, pharmacy and fresh fish stall are within approximately 250 metres of the cottage. Lloyds Bank, Barclays bank (with ATM) and a small number of galleries, craft shops and clothing stores are all within a 5 minute walk. The famous St Mawes Castle, built by Henry VIII, with stunning views of Carrick Roads (the 3rd largest natural harbour in the world) is just a 10 minute walk from the cottage.
